Mathew Sweezey is regarded as one of the leading minds on the future of marketing. During his interview with host Paul Roetzer, Sweezey discusses the “Post AI Consumer,” and how AI has already changed the way consumers connect, find things, interface with technology, and make purchasing decisions.

Note: This video was recorded live during an interview for our Marketing AI Podcast. The audio podcast is available on your favorite podcast app.
Watch the whole interview to hear more about:
How “deep fakes” can actually be a positive thing.
Shopping on the "edge," and why it’s the next major wave of commerce.
How you can adapt to a world in which AI powers everything.
Ways to understand and apply AI in your career now.
Meet Your Interviewee

Mathew Sweezey

Mathew Sweezey is the director of market strategy for Salesforce, and author of The Context Marketing Revolution (HBR 2020). He is regarded as one of the leading minds on the future of marketing and his visionary insights into consumer behavior, technology and new business strategies have changed the way startups, Fortune 500 and nonprofit organizations alike find customers, break through, and build modern brands. In addition to his work with brands, Sweezey is the host of the award-winning podcast The Electronic Propaganda Society and an accomplished writer having written for The Economist, Forbes, HBR The Observer, and Adage.
